Part 1. Text Pure Monopoly
The perfectly competitive firm is too small to worry about the effect of its own decisions on industry output. In contrast, a pure monopoly is the entire industry.
A monopolist is the sole supplier or potential supplier of the industry’s output.
A sole national supplier need not be a monopoly. If it raises prices, it may face competition from imports or from domestic entrants to the industry. In contrast, a pure monopoly does not need to worry about potential competition.
Profi t-maximising output
To maximise profits, a monopolist chooses the output at which marginal revenue MR equals marginal cost MC, then checks that it is covering average costs. Fig. 2 shows the average cost curve AC with its usual U- shape. Marginal revenue MR lies below the down-sloping demand curve DD. The monopolist recognizes that, to sell extra units, it has to lower the price, even for existing customers.
Fig. 2. The monopolist’s decision
Setting MR = MC, the monopolist chooses the output Q1. The demand curve DD implies that the monopolist sells Q1 at a price P1 per unit. Profit

Even in the long run, the monopolist continues to make these monopoly profits. By ruling out the possibility of entry, we remove the mechanism by which profits are competed away in the long run by additional supply.
Price-setting
A competitive firm is a price-taker, taking as given the price determined by supply and demand at the industry level. In contrast, the monopolist is a price-setter. Having decided to make Q1, the monopolist quotes a price P1 knowing the output Q1 will be bought at this price.
When demand is elastic, lower prices increase revenue by raising quantity demanded a lot. When revenue rises, the marginal revenue from the extra output is positive. Conversely, when demand is inelastic, marginal revenue is negative. To raise quantity demanded, prices must be cut so much that total revenue falls.
To maximise profits, a monopolist sets MC = MR. Since MC is always positive, MR must be positive. But this means that demand is elastic at this output. Hence, in Fig. 2, the chosen output must lie to the left of Q2. A monopolist will never produce on the inelastic part of the demand curve where MR is negative.
Monopoly power
At any output, price exceeds a monopolist’s marginal revenue since the demand curve slopes down. In setting MR = MC, the monopolist sets a price above marginal cost. In contrast, a competitive firm equates price and marginal cost, since its price is also its marginal revenue. A competitive firm cannot raise price above marginal cost. It has no monopoly power.
Monopoly power is measured by price minus marginal cost.
Changes in profi t-maximising output
Fig. 2 may also be used to analyse the effect of changes in costs or demand. Suppose higher input prices shift the MC and AC curves up. The higher MC curve must cross the MR curve at a lower output. The cost increase must reduce output. Since the demand curve slopes down, lower output induces a higher equilibrium price.

Similarly, with the original cost curves, an upward shift in demand and marginal revenue curves means that MR now crosses MC at a higher output. The monopolist raises output.
Discriminating monopoly
Thus far, all consumers were charged the same price. Unlike a competitive industry, where competition prevents any individual firm charging more than its competitors, a monopolist may be able to charge different prices to different customers.
A discriminating monopoly charges different prices to different buyers. Consider an airline monopolising flights between London and Rome.
It has business customers whose demand curve is very inelastic. They have to fly. Their demand and marginal revenue curves are very steep. The airline also carries tourists whose demand curve is much more elastic. If flights to Rome are too dear, tourists can visit Athens instead. Tourists have much flatter demand and marginal revenue curves. The airline will charge the two groups different prices. Since tourist demand is elastic the airline wants to charge tourists a low fare to increase tourist revenue. Since business demand is inelastic the airline wants to charge business travellers a high fare to increase business revenue.
Profit-maximising output will satisfy two separate conditions. First, business travellers with inelastic demand will pay a fare sufficiently higher than tourists with elastic demand that the marginal revenue from the two separate groups is equated. Then there is no incentive to rearrange the mix by altering the price differential between the two groups. Second, the general level of prices and the total number of passengers are chosen to equate marginal cost to both these marginal revenues. This ensures that the airline operates on the most profitable scale as well as with the most profitable mix.
When a producer charges different customers different prices we say it price discriminates. There are many examples in the real world. Rail operators charge rush-hour commuters a higher fare than mid-day shoppers whose demand for trips to the city is much more elastic. Price discrimination often applies to services, which must be consumed on the spot, rather than to goods, which can be resold. Price discrimination in standardised goods will not work. The group buying at the lower price resells to the group paying the higher price, undercutting the price differences. Effective price discrimination requires that the submarkets can be isolated from one another to prevent resale.

Fig. 3 illustrates perfect price discrimination where it is possible to charge every customer a different price for the same good. If the monopolist charges every customer the same price, the profit-maximising output is Q1, where MR equals MC, and the corresponding price is P1. If the monopolist can perfectly price discriminate, the very first unit can be sold for a price E. Having sold this unit to the highest bidder, the customer most desperate for the good, the next unit is sold to the next highest bidder, and so on. In reducing the price to sell that extra unit, the monopolist no longer reduces revenue from previously sold units. The demand curve is the marginal revenue curve under perfect price discrimination. The marginal revenue of the last unit is simply the price for which it is sold.
Fig. 3. Perfect price discrimination
A perfectly price discriminating monopolist produces at C where MC = DD which is now marginal revenue. Price discrimination, if possible, is always profitable. In moving from the uniform pricing points to the price discriminating point C, the monopolist adds the area ABC to profits. This is the excess of additional revenue over additional cost when output is higher.
The monopolist makes a second gain from price discrimination. Even the output Q1 now brings in more revenue than under uniform pricing. The monopolist also gains the area EP1A by charging different prices, rather than the single price P1, on the first Q1 units. Economic consultants often earn their fees by teaching firms new ways in which to price discriminate.

Monopoly and technical change
Joseph Schumpeter (1883–1950) argued that, even with uniform pricing, a monopoly may not produce a lower output and at a higher price than a competitive industry, because the monopolist has more incentive to shift its cost curves down.
Technical advances reduce costs, and allow lower prices higher output. A monopoly has more incentive to undertake research and development (R&D), necessary for cost-saving breakthroughs.
In a competitive industry, a firm with a technical advantage has only a temporary opportunity to earn high profits to recoup its research expenses. Imitation by existing firms and new entrants soon compete away its profits. In contrast, by shifting down all its cost curves, a monopoly can enjoy higher profits for ever. Schumpeter argued that monopolies are more innovative than competitive industries. Taking a dynamic long-run view, rather than a snapshot static picture, monopolists may enjoy lower cost curves that lead them to charge lower prices, thereby raising the quantity demanded.

Online Piracy
Widespread and illegal downloading of copyright recordings from the internet has fuelled a boom in the pirate music market, costing copyright owners £3 billion in lost sales in 2000.
Financial Times, 13 June 2001
18
New legitimate online distribution services, run by music companies and with proper charges, should help limit music piracy. So should successful court cases against the pirates. The music industry trade body IPFI estimated that 36 per cent of CDs and cassettes were pirated in 2000. IPF1 managed to close down 15 000 illegal websites containing 300000 music files. Downloads from Napster fell from 2.8 billion in February 2001 to a mere 400000 after a US court case.

Part 1. Text. Imperfect Competition and Market
Structure
Perfect competition and pure monopoly are useful benchmarks of extreme kinds of market structure. Most markets lie between these two extremes. What determines the structure of a particular market? Why are there 10 000 florists but only a handful of chemical producers? How does the structure of an industry affect the behaviour of its constituent firms?
A perfectly competitive firm faces a horizontal demand curve at the going market price. It is a price-taker. Any other type of firm faces a down- ward-sloping demand curve for its product and is an imperfectly competitive firm.
An imperfectly competitive firm recognises that its demand curve slopes down.
For a pure monopoly, the demand curve for the firm is the industry demand curve itself. We now distinguish two intermediate cases of an imperfectly competitive market structure.
An oligopoly is an industry with only a few, interdependent producers. An industry with monopolistic competition has many sellers making products that are close but not perfect substitutes for one another. Each firm then has a limited ability to affect its output price.

Table 1 offers an overview of market structure. As with most definitions, the distinctions can get a little blurred. How do we define the relevant market? Was British Gas a monopoly in gas or an oligopolist in energy? Similarly, when a country trades in a competitive world market, even the sole domestic producer may have little influence on market price.
